Officers investigating reports of suspicious activity at retail stores in Macclesfield and Hanford have renewed their appeal for information.
On Monday 4th August, police received reports of a man acting suspiciously at two retail stores in Macclesfield town centre.
Then, on Friday 8th August, police received reports of a man matching the same description acting suspiciously at two retail stores in the Handforth area.
During the incident the man was seen acting suspiciously and following lone women.
Enquiries in relation to the incident have been ongoing and officers have now released CCTV footage of a man they are keen to speak to.
Inspector Richard Haque, of Macclesfield Local Policing Unit, said:
“These are extremely concerning incidents, and we are keen to trace this man as soon as possible.
“The footage is extremely clear, and I would urge anyone who recognises the man to get in touch.
Information can be reported via www.cheshire.police.uk/tell-us or by calling 101, quoting IML 2150470.
“I would also like to appeal directly to the man pictured to come forward.”
